Different career paths in air force aviation:

Numerous positions in the Air Force follow career paths that are comparable to those of the general workforce. Learning about these professions can give you more options as you plan your future.

Administrative assistant:

The administrative assistant is mainly responsible for coordinating official procedures such as hiring and training new air force employees. They know about the regulations of the air force and the proper documenting process for new employees. In America, the average salary for an administrative assistant is $37138 annually.

Electrician:

The main task of an air force electrician is fixing and maintaining different electrical equipment. They are responsible for inspecting defective equipment and faulty wiring in electrical systems. In America, the average salary for an electrician is $38746 annually.

Mechanic:

The main goal of the mechanic is to execute a comprehensive inspection of the electrical system. They are also responsible for the documentation process of equipment. They also keep updating maintenance data about types of equipment and aircraft. In America, the average salary for mechanics is $40626 annually.

Aircraft maintenance technician:

These technicians are responsible for performing the inspection of aircraft. They make sure that aircraft normally fly without any technical defects. They inspect the aircraft before and after the flight. The average salary for an aircraft technician in America is $47589 annually.

Security Forces:

The security forces are responsible for the airbase’s and its employees’ security and safety. Their main tasks include checking people coming in and out of the base and security cameras to avoid unfavorable circumstances. The security forces always stay alert and work with other law enforcement agencies. In America, the average salary for security forces is $49431 annually.

Intelligence specialist:

 The intelligence specialist is responsible for creating thorough all-source targeting packages and reports for use in operations to meet the requirements of bilateral partners and program priorities. Additionally, they choose targets based on the task’s demands and the locals’ needs for safety. In America, the average salary for an intelligence analyst is $64694 annually.

Pilot:

The pilot is responsible for operating the aircraft. They make sure that aircraft have no technical issues before flying. The pilot job is quite tough and adventurous at the same time. The pilot receives many pieces of training to ensure people’s safety. In America, the average salary for a pilot is $78408 annually.
